L. ZIADE

Project Chill: Memoirs of a Jazz Band

2006-01-02

Lorel Zaide (“ZAY-dee”) was born and raised in Chicago as a first generation American to parents from the Philippines. He earned a degree in Hotel/restaurant management from UNLV while playing in Las Vegas Jazz clubs and running a DJ business. He moved back to Chicago, then rounded up his Las Vegas jazz band to record this album of 10 of the most popular jazz tunes ever written. The band is tight but safe, but this will do quite well if you are in the mood for standards. - Pete
